Dear Residents and Members, Ram Viswanathan
Interim Secretary 
Just over six weeks ago, we had an EGM where you elected our
Interim Executive Committee team. After the EGM had concluded,
the ex-President Mr Jana handed over the keys to the sealed cabinet
where the ex-Secretary had placed the documents of the Association.
The cabinet was unsealed in Mr Jana’s presence. There was no
document list or a checklist present inside. Hence, a checklist was
prepared on Sunday, August 12, 2018 in the presence of Mr Jana and
some of the Interim EC members.

We are putting a process in place for document handling and its
storage so that the Association’s agreements, filings, etc. are secure,
easy to locate, access and track going forward.

We would also like to announce that the Interim Executive
Committee shall make ourselves available at the OGCOWA office in
Tower 34 Ground Floor every Saturday between 11 am and 1 pm for
members who have any queries, or wish to talk on a regular basis.
Any changes or updates to this schedule will be published via ADDA
and WhatsApp.
